Redis通道订阅不再错失重要消息(redis通道订阅)

Redis通道订阅是一种强大的消息发布和订阅功能,它使企业可以在应用之间实时传播重要数据。它允许一个应用程序将它的数据发布给多个应用程序,并且能够有效地管理信息,避免信息的丢失。

使用Redis的发布订阅机制,可以实现应用程序间的实时通信,而无需依赖中间件或权限服务器,可以有效地减少系统延迟时间和额外消耗。Redis发布订阅机制可以充分利用多个订阅者和发布者构建复杂的通信系统。虽然客户端可以从Redis存储中发布和获取一般消息,但是当有许多客户端需要实时消息时,Redis通道订阅特别有用。

Redis的发布订阅模式允许发布者将消息发布到一个频道,多个订阅者可以订阅该频道以接收发布的消息。

下面是一个使用Redis的发布订阅功能的示例代码:

Subscriber:

//ES6
let Redis = require("redis").Redis;
let subscriber = new Redis();
subscriber.on("message", (channel, message) => {
console.log(`Received message ${message} on channel ${channel}`);
});

subscriber.subscribe("important_channel");

Publisher:

//ES6
let Redis = require("redis").Redis;
let publisher = new Redis();
publisher.publish("important_channel", "This is an important message");

Redis的发布订阅功能是一种强大的消息发布和订阅功能,可以有效地帮助企业在应用之间实时传播重要数据,而不会错过重要消息。它是一种高性能、高可用性、高可靠性和可扩展性的解决方案,可以有效地改善企业应用程序之间的消息传递。


数据运维技术 » Redis通道订阅不再错失重要消息(redis通道订阅)